About Wyatt

Wyatt is a strong and timeless baby boy name that has its roots in Old English. Derived from the elements "wig" and "heard," Wyatt signifies a brave warrior who stands tall in the face of challenges. The name's association with courage and strength makes it a popular choice for parents seeking a name that exudes confidence and resilience.

Wyatt has a rich history, with notable figures like Wyatt Earp contributing to its legacy. In recent times, the name has been embraced by celebrities and entertainers, further cementing its prominence.

With variations such as Wiot and Wyat, Wyatt offers some flexibility while retaining its distinct character. The name is often shortened to affectionate nicknames like Wy or Wybie, adding a touch of familiarity.
